λῆξις

lexis2 · ἡ

cessation, death, decease, termination

Generated live from the audited corpus — every figure on this page is a database query, not prose from memory.

What it meant

λῆξις · lēxis — LSJ

cessation

cessation, μόχθων, ἀνέμων, A. Eu. 505 (lyr.), A.R. 1.1086; of the flow of a river, Ph. 1.175; τῆς ἐνεργείας λῆξιν λαμβανούσης Gal. Phil.Hist. 17, cf. M.Ant. 9.21.

2 death, decease

death, decease, PMasp. 19.6 (vi A.D.), etc.

II termination

Gramm., termination, A.D. Synt. 104.28; λ. ἡ εἰς ς̄ Id. Adv. 195.27.

III end, extremity

end, extremity, τοῦ κόλου Sor. 1.7.
